PKR election: Another Deputy Minister loses

JOHOR BAHRU: Deputy Minister of Energy Transition and Water Transformation, Akmal Nasrullah Mohd Nasir, failed to defend his Johor Bahru Branch Chief position in this PKR election.
The Johor Bahru Member of Parliament lost unexpectedly to his challenger, who is also the Johor Justice Youth Force (AMK) leader, Mohamad Taufiq Ismail.
Based on the official results released by the PKR Central Election Committee (JPP), Akmal Nasrullah obtained 587 votes compared to Mohamad Taufiq (709 votes).
The decision was signed by the Chairman of the JPP, Datuk Seri Dr Zaliha Mustafa.
A total of 1,296 ballot papers were issued, while a total of 1,789 members were eligible to vote for the branch in question in the election.
However, the decision surprised many of Akmal Nasrullah's supporters as he had previously hinted in a Facebook post that he would win the Johor Bahru Branch Head position with a simple majority of support.
Akmal, a former PKR Youth chief now the party's strategy director, was elected as the branch chief in 2014.
